## Runbook: Spokewise Rebalancer — Restart Procedure

If dispatchers report stale dock counts, the Spokewise rebalancing tool has likely lost its feed from the station poller. First confirm the poller is running, then restart the rebalancer service on the Marlowe host. Allow two minutes for dock data to repopulate before confirming with the dispatcher. On restart, the service loads the configuration values shown below.

service settings:
[istox]
host = istox.qorvelforge.internal
user = istox_svc
database = istox_prod

## Notes — Pixelbin cache leak

- Leak confirmed in the thumbnail cache; evictions never fire under burst load.
- Hotfix caps cache at 512 MB; real fix lands next sprint.
- Support: advise affected users to restart the Lumira client as a stopgap.
- Do not promise a date yet.

All escalations on this leak go to the engineer named below.

named custodian: Oliath Ralax

Ticket #4412 — Stale-cache postmortem follow-up

The Quillhaven staging box served week-old pricing because its env pointed at the retired cache tier. We have corrected the host entry and documented the fix for support. To finish remediation, each affected instance must authenticate against the new cache broker, so append the following line:

sealed setting: ARCHIVE_KEY3=202

For the finance team: this review covers the decision on expanding capacity at the Ollenbridge plant. Current utilisation sits at 94%, and order intake for the Ferron valve line suggests a shortfall within three quarters. Option A adds a second shift at modest cost; Option B is a full line extension requiring significant capital and a fourteen-month build. Payback modelling favours Option A near term, though it caps growth. Marta Quill will present both cases to the board. The confidential note below records the preferred direction.

confidential, kagup-bafog: Fraaxax Group is in early talks to buy Soroxox Group for about $343.8 million. The Olidor launch date is June 14, and nothing goes to the press before then. Legal wants the Aldmirek Logistics term sheet signed before July 23.